March 2025 – Current Report on Domestic Trade

In March 2025, domestic trade sales grew by 6.0% compared to March 2024. This increase is mainly attributed to the positive performance of department stores, supermarkets, home improvement, and pharmacies, driven by a roughly 4% rise in domestic demand. The standout sectors were supermarkets and hypermarkets (+5.8%), department stores (+3.6%), hardware and finishing stores (+2.0%), home furnishings (+14.7%), and pharmacies and drugstores (+10.9%).
